Composition and Classification

The drug's composition is anchored by its two active ingredients [INN]. Ambroxol is recognized for its secretolytic and secretomotor action, which helps to thin and clear viscous respiratory secretions and improve airway secretion management. Concurrently, Loratadine acts as the H1-receptor antagonist, blocking the effects of histamine release, the primary chemical trigger for allergic symptoms such as swelling and itching. The strategic combination of these two synthetic substances—one for physical secretion management and one for chemical allergy mitigation—is a unique differentiation factor of FDC products like Bronar.

What side effects are possible with Bronar?

Possible Side Effects and Safety Information

The safety profile of Bronar, a fixed-dose combination containing Ambroxol and Loratadine, is characterized by adverse reactions documented across multiple System-Organ Classes (SOCs), consistent with official regulatory labeling.

Adverse effects are classified by frequency as observed in regulatory documentation:

  • Common: Reactions that may affect up to 1 in 10 people include Headache, Somnolence (drowsiness), Fatigue, Nausea, Dysgeusia (taste disturbance), and Oral or Pharyngeal hypoesthesia (numbness of the mouth or throat).
  • Uncommon: These include Diarrhoea, Vomiting, Dyspepsia, Insomnia, and Dry mouth.
  • Rare: Effects in this category include Tachycardia (rapid heartbeat), Palpitations, Abnormal hepatic function, and Hypersensitivity reactions.

System-Organ Class Groupings

The most frequently associated SOCs are Nervous System Disorders (e.g., somnolence) and Gastrointestinal Disorders (e.g., nausea, dry mouth).

Serious Adverse Reactions

The official safety documents identify rare but clinically serious adverse reactions. These include Anaphylactic reactions (e.g., anaphylactic shock) and severe, life-threatening skin reactions known as Severe Cutaneous Adverse Reactions (SCARs), such as Stevens-Johnson syndrome (SJS) and Toxic epidermal necrolysis (TEN), documented with Ambroxol.

Population-Specific Safety Constraints

Official labeling mandates caution for use in individuals with severe renal impairment or severe hepatic impairment. This is due to the potential for increased systemic exposure and accumulation of the active components in these populations, requiring careful safety assessment as defined by regulatory authorities.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documentation classifies the interaction profile of Bronar based on two primary constraints relating to its active components: Loratadine and Ambroxol.

Documented Pharmacokinetic Interactions

Co-administration with strong inhibitors of liver enzymes CYP3A4 and CYP2D6 can significantly affect the body’s processing of Loratadine. Medicinal products such as Ketoconazole, Erythromycin, and Cimetidine substantially increase the plasma concentrations ( AUC and C max) of Loratadine, thereby increasing systemic exposure. Food intake also leads to an approximately 48% increase in Loratadine’s systemic exposure.

Interaction-Related Restrictions and Conditions

Classification Restriction or Condition
Pharmacodynamic Restriction Co-administration with cough suppressants (antitussives) is generally not recommended due to the risk of bronchial secretion accumulation and potential airway obstruction, a documented effect of the mucolytic component.
Procedural Constraint Loratadine must be discontinued for at least 48 hours before any diagnostic allergen skin testing to prevent interference with test results.
Tissue Concentration Effect The Ambroxol component is documented to increase the concentration of certain antibiotics (e.g., Amoxicillin, Cefuroxime) within bronchopulmonary secretions.

Population-Specific Notes

In cases of severe hepatic or renal impairment, the body's clearance of both Ambroxol metabolites and Loratadine may be reduced. This physiological dependency increases the potential for drug and metabolite accumulation, intensifying systemic exposure and related interaction risks.

Dosage and Administration Information

The fixed-dose combination, Bronar, is intended exclusively for oral administration, available in preparations such as tablets, capsules, or oral solutions. The standard dosing regimen is structured around a once-daily schedule, which aligns with the pharmacokinetic profile of the antihistamine component. For adult use, the daily dose typically contains the equivalent of 10 mg of Loratadine combined with an established amount of Ambroxol, commonly in the 30 mg to 60 mg range, and the total Loratadine component must not exceed 10 mg per 24 hours.


Administration Scope

Instruction Detail
Route of administration Oral (Tablet, Solution, Capsule)
Dosing schedule Once daily
Timing in relation to meals Can be taken with or without food

Population-Specific Instructions

Dose modifications are described for certain populations. Patients diagnosed with severe hepatic impairment or severe renal impairment (creatinine clearance < 30 mL/min) adjust the standard dose to be taken every other day. Pediatric dosing for children aged six years and older uses the full daily adult equivalent (10 mg Loratadine), while children between two and five years require a lower 5 mg Loratadine equivalent once daily.

When administering the oral solution form, a calibrated measuring device is used to ensure dose accuracy. If a dose is inadvertently missed, the standard approach involves skipping the missed dose if the time for the next scheduled dose is near, and under no circumstances should two doses be taken simultaneously to compensate. The overall use is typically short-term, limited to periods when symptoms are acute.

Q: How quickly can I expect Bronar to start working?

A: Regulatory documents indicate that the antihistamine component of Bronar is described as exhibiting an effect that is typically observed soon after administration. According to the official product information, effects can be seen within 1 to 3 hours, with the maximum benefit generally occurring between 8 and 12 hours after administration.


Q: How long does Bronar stay in your system?

A: Official information describes how the body processes the medicine. The major active substance from the antihistamine component has a mean elimination half-life of approximately 28 hours in healthy adults.


Q: Can Bronar make you feel tired or sleepy?

A: Official safety information documents list Somnolence (drowsiness) and Fatigue as common adverse reactions. These effects are reported to potentially affect up to 1 in 10 people who use the medicine.


Q: What are the most common side effects of Bronar reported by users?

A: Based on official safety information, the common reactions listed include headache, somnolence, and fatigue. Other commonly reported effects are nausea, dysgeusia (taste disturbance), and numbness of the mouth or throat.

How should Bronar be stored and disposed of?

Storage and Disposal Requirements for Bronar (Ambroxol/Loratadine)

The stability and quality of Bronar (Ambroxol/Loratadine) are preserved by following specific storage conditions defined in regulatory labeling.


Storage Requirements

Condition Requirement
Temperature Store at controlled room temperature, typically 20 C to 25 C (68 F to 77 F). Do not freeze the product.
Protection Keep the medicine in its original package and ensure the container is tightly closed to protect from moisture.
Safety The product must be kept out of the sight and reach of children.

Disposal Instructions

Do not use the medicine after the labeled expiry date. Disposal of unused or expired product must follow local official guidelines. Many regulatory bodies advise against throwing the medicine away via wastewater or household waste to prevent environmental impact. Patients should consult a pharmacist for guidance on proper disposal procedures.
